
파이썬 공부 레벨 1의 6단계:리스트
리스트 기본
# 리스트 생성
fruits = ['apple', 'banana', 'cherry']
numbers = [1, 2, 3, 4, 5]
# 리스트 길이
print(len(fruits)) # 3
리스트 조작
# 요소 추가
fruits.append('orange') # 끝에 추가
fruits.insert(1, 'grape') # 특정 위치에 추가
# 요소 삭제
fruits.remove('banana') # 특정 요소 삭제
del fruits[0] # 특정 인덱스 삭제
리스트 슬라이싱
# 리스트 자르기
print(fruits[1:3]) # 1번부터 2번 인덱스까지
print(fruits[:2]) # 처음부터 2번 인덱스 전까지
print(fruits[-2:]) # 뒤에서 2개 요소
도전 과제! 🏆
- 좋아하는 과일 5개를 리스트로 만들기
- 리스트의 길이 출력
- 마지막 과일 삭제
- 새로운 과일 추가
- 전체 리스트 출력
꿀팁:
- 리스트는 순서가 있는 수정 가능한 데이터
- 다양한 타입의 데이터 저장 가능
- 인덱스는 0부터 시작해요
정답은 ?!
정답 (접은글을 펼쳐보세요~!)
더보기
# 과일 리스트 조작 프로그램
# 1. 좋아하는 과일 5개 리스트로 만들기
fruits = ['사과', '바나나', '딸기', '포도', '키위']
# 2. 리스트의 길이 출력
print(f"과일 리스트의 길이: {len(fruits)}개")
# 3. 마지막 과일 삭제
fruits.pop() # 또는 del fruits[-1]
# 4. 새로운 과일 추가
fruits.append('오렌지')
# 5. 전체 리스트 출력
print("현재 과일 리스트:")
print(fruits)
과일 리스트의 길이: 5개
현재 과일 리스트:
['사과', '바나나', '딸기', '포도', '오렌지']
파이썬 공부 재미있다 !!
기초부터 확실하게 !!
'프로그래밍 > 파이썬' 카테고리의 다른 글
| 파이썬 공부 레벨 1의 8단계: 함수 🧙♂️✨ (2) | 2024.11.20 |
|---|---|
| 파이썬 공부 레벨 1의 7단계: 반복문🧙♂️✨ (0) | 2024.11.19 |
| 파이썬 공부 레벨 1의 5단계: 문자열 🧙♂️✨ (5) | 2024.11.15 |
| 파이썬 공부 레벨 1의 4단계: 연산자와 형 변환 🌈🔢 (3) | 2024.11.14 |
| 파이썬 공부 레벨 1의 3단계: 조건문 🧙♂️🔮 (1) | 2024.11.13 |